Overall, our results lead us to conclude that the chickpea ortholog of ELF3 is responsible for the qdf-SD5 QTL on Ca5 and that this gene is equivalent to the previously described Efl1 locus. The identification of flowering time QTLs in this study has revealed several genetic regions of interest for breeders seeking to develop chickpea cultivars with reduced photoperiod response and earlier flowering (Table I). Domesticated chickpea (Cicer arietinum) is an important member of the legume family cultivated across more than 13.5 million ha globally, with major production centers in India, Australia, Pakistan, Turkey, Burma, Iran, Canada, and the United States (FAOSTAT, 2014; Gaur et al., 2015). In this study, we mapped, sequenced, and characterized Early flowering1 (Efl1), an ortholog of Arabidopsis (Arabidopsis thaliana) EARLY FLOWERING3 (ELF3) that confers early flowering in chickpea. The resulting narrow genetic base presents difficulties for chickpea breeders now seeking to develop even earlier flowering cultivars that mature within the extremely short growing seasons encountered in many of the major chickpea growing regions. Chickpeas prefer warmer growing conditions — average temperatures below 15º C will reduce pollen viability and can cause flower drop, and average temperatures over 35º C will lower the potential yield and cause possible flower abortion. ICCV 96029 is essentially photoperiod insensitive, whereas other lines carrying the efl1 mutation still show considerable response to daylength. The 11-bp deletion was associated with early flowering in global chickpea germplasm but was not widely distributed, indicating that this mutation arose relatively recently. A succession of evolutionary bottlenecks has resulted in domesticated chickpea germplasm with unusually limited genetic diversity (Abbo et al., 2003).
